Stonework rep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the integrity of stone structures on residential and commercial properties. These services typically involve addressing issues such as cracked, chipped, or weathered stone surfaces, as well as fixing mortar joints that have deteriorated over time. Skilled professionals assess the condition of the stonework and perform repairs that may include replacing damaged stones, repointing mortar joints, and sealing surfaces to prevent further damage. The goal is to preserve the aesthetic appeal and structural stability of stone features, ensuring they remain safe and visually appealing.
These repair services help solve common problems caused by natural wear, weather exposure, and environmental factors. Over time, stones can develop cracks or become loose, leading to potential safety hazards or further deterioration if not addressed promptly. Mortar joints may crumble or erode, weakening the overall stability of stone walls and facades. Repairing these issues not only restores the appearance of the stonework but also prevents more extensive damage that could result in costly replacements. Proper maintenance through professional repair can extend the lifespan of stone features and maintain their value.

Material Repair Costs - Repairing stonework due to cracks or chips typically ranges from $300 to $1,000 depending on the extent of damage and stone type. Smaller repairs may be closer to the lower end, while extensive fixes can approach the higher end.
Masonry Restoration Expenses - Restoring or resurfacing stone surfaces generally costs between $1,500 and $4,500. Factors influencing costs include the size of the area and the complexity of the work involved.
Labor and Service Fees - Labor charges for stonework repair services often fall between $50 and $150 per hour. Total costs depend on the project's scope, with larger projects requiring more hours and resources.
Project Cost Variability - Overall costs for stonework repair services can vary widely, typically ranging from $500 to over $10,000 for large or intricate projects. Contact local service providers for precise est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
